WRITERS
You are
going to explore how legends and myths are born and prepare a game to
illustrate this cultural mechanism.
To do
so, 3-4 children who are good at storytelling leave the room (so as not to hear
what is happening in the classroom). While they are out, one person tells the
rest of the class the myth of Zeus and Europa. The task of the students is to
listen carefully and remember as much as possible.
When
the story has been told, one of the storytellers comes back to the classroom
and a volunteer from among other students tells the legend. When he / she has
finished, another student is asked to come back to the classroom and the one
who was listening now tells him/her the legend, paying attention to all the
details. The situation is repeated until
all the students waiting in the corridor are back in the classroom. The last
person tells the legend back to the whole class. Each time students must be
warned that they need to pay attention so as to remember as many details as
possible.
Accoring to the legend, somewhere on the Asian shore of the Mediterranean, around where Lebanon is now situated, there lived a princess called Europa. Her father was king Agenor.
One night, Europa had a dream. She dreamt that
two women argued about her. One, called Asia, wanted her to stay where she was.
The other one got an order from god Zeus to bring her close to the sea.
Next morning, Europa was on the shore, picking
flowers. Suddenly she saw a huge, gentle, white bull. It behaved so well that
Europa thought he was completely tame and eventually sat on his back. As soon
as she did so, the bull jumped into the sea and started swimming very fast. She
was too scared to jump off and so she let the bull carry her away. On the way,
the bull explained that he was in fact Zeus, a got, and that he only took on a
form of an animal.
Having abducted Europa, Zeus took her to the
island of Crete and married her there.

ARTISTS
You are going to explore visual materials on the Europa myth.
The name of the continent comes from the name of a princess who married the
king of the gods – Zeus. This myth provided inspiration to a variety of artists
from different countries. Find some works of art that were inspired by this
myth. These could include for example: paintings, drawings, sculptures, theatre
plays, operas, pieces of music. Try to present the myth using a form of comic
and then try to present artistic inspirations of the myth using a form of a
poster (choose a technique that best suits your needs).
